Folkena's payroll engine is pure, testable and mapped one-to-one to Turkish legislation. The 2026 minimum wage, SGK rates, income-tax brackets, disability relief and exemptions are written into the code — no manual updates every month.
It computes every statutory deduction from gross to net; if you have a net-salary contract, an iterative solver works the gross back to the kuruş.
It produces a month's payroll for all active employees in a single run, pulling data from the modules automatically.
Payroll automatically becomes a double-entry journal voucher; reversals are supported.
It produces net salaries in your chosen bank format and delivers each payslip to the employee.
When the payroll total exceeds 10,000 ₺, CFO/manager authorisation is required for approval. For garnishments, the Enforcement & Bankruptcy Law a.83 limit (¼ of salary) applies; for advances and disciplinary deductions, the Code of Obligations a.407 limit applies cumulatively. An approved period cannot be recalculated — the audit trail is preserved.
From entry/exit to the APHB, from severance and notice pay to unused-leave payouts — official processes and calculations are automated, with statutory article references.
Leave types compliant with Turkish Labour Law No. 4857, tenure-based accrual, smart timesheets and location-verified mobile time tracking — with overtime and night work checked against statutory limits.
The system ships with legal references built in; each company adds its own types.
It derives accrued days from start and birth dates and manages the balance.
It automatically splits regular / overtime / night / holiday minutes from clock-in and clock-out times.
Every clock-in/out carries a GPS point; distance is computed server-side and flagged inside/outside the geo-fence.
